Pike Greed !! May 2006These pictures were sent to me. THANK YOU! The gentleman found a large dead pike on the shore of a southern Alberta pike lake. In its mouth was a smaller pike. Pike can't choke directly because they breath through gills. So I asked a fisheries biologist about this and he speculated that the large pike would have suffocated because its gills could not work properly and there was not enough oxygenated water passing over the gills. The smaller pikewas extracted and photographed with the predator pike. The small pike was about 60 percent of the body length of the larger fish !! What was the big fish thinking?! Once the smaller fish was part way in the predator's teeth probably prevented the smaller fish from being regurgitated. In any case, the larger fish likely had no intentions of spitting out the food.
